TS 7000 door locking system
Our new TS 7000 door closer system was a very special highlight that met with enormous interest. © GEZE GmbH
With the future-oriented and high-performance door closer system, GEZE is responding to constantly increasing requirements and offers an all-round carefree solution with maximum convenience, safety even in demanding installation situations and complete accessibility. The adaptive hydraulics of the TS 7000 with innovative Easyflow technology ensure greater safety and convenience in operation and, thanks to the innovative technology for temperature stability, the system impresses with consistent closing behaviour in all seasons.
The SNAPnFIX installation aid makes installation easier than ever before.
- Adaptive hydraulics with innovative Easyflow technology: greater safety and convenience when opening and closing
- Temperature stability: Consistent closing behaviour in all seasons
- Optimised installation aid with SNAPnFIX: easier to install than ever before
- Sustainability: Over 1 million tested cycles for maximum durability
Will be launched in early 2026.
System for securing automated windows with IQ box Safety
The IQ box Safety ensures the safe closing of automated ventilation windows by securing the main and secondary closing edges. © GEZE GmbH
The safe closing of automated ventilation windows by securing the main and secondary closing edges is also a central, very important topic. GEZE Switzerland presented its innovative system for securing automated windows with IQ box Safety.
This system not only guarantees a reliable closing function, but also makes a decisive contribution to safety when using automated ventilation technology.
- Fulfils the highest protection class requirements according to the risk assessment for power-operated windows in accordance with the Machinery Directive (protection class 4)
- TÜV-tested functional safety in accordance with DIN EN 13849-1
- Four sensor connections, can be assigned with safety edges or non-contact sensors
- Top-hat rail housing with plug-in terminals for quick and easy wiring
- Integrated push-button for manually closing the windows during servicing
- Quick and easy commissioning thanks to preset standard parameters
- Parameters can be customised with Service Terminal ST 220
The IQ box Safety ensures the safe closing of automated ventilation windows by protecting the main and secondary closing edges. If sensors detect a foreign object, the window is stopped or the closing movement is reversed. In schools and nurseries in particular, this type of finger-trap protection is necessary in order to realise automated ventilation, as children are considered to be particularly vulnerable.
Building management - centralised, secure and convenient
myGEZE Control building automation system © GEZE GmbH
Another focus topic of GEZE Switzerland was networking in building management. The innovative myGEZE Control building automation system with its wide range of application options was presented. From individual buildings to entire building complexes - as a facility manager or operator, it is not easy to maintain an overview of your buildings and the associated technology. This requires innovative building automation solutions. With myGEZE Control, GEZE offers the option of networking door, window and safety systems and controlling them centrally in a building management system. Either in a building management system or in GEZE's own building management system myGEZE Visu.
